Just as important the organization needs to document that 1) this is their
process and 2) they are following it...

> I know organizations that do it, chiefly because data volumes make reviews
> meaningless and sign-offs completely unfeasible.  However, I agree that
> this isn't a policy that should initiate from RIM.  The organization as an
> entity needs to decide that this is how it will do things, and everybody
> has to be on board with living with the consequences, whether voluntarily
> or by executive fiat.  RIM's simply not in a position most times to either
> get the universal buy-in or issue the fiat.
